The Opportunity

StaffRight Associates is seeking a high-caliber Reliability & Maintenance Engineer to spearhead the evolution of equipment performance and operational integrity at a premier manufacturing facility in the Greater Morristown area. This is a critical leadership mandate focused on architecting a robust reliability framework from the ground up. You will serve as the primary catalyst for eliminating downtime and optimizing the lifecycle of complex production assets, directly influencing the facility’s capacity, safety, and bottom-line success.


What You’ll Do

  • Architect and advance a comprehensive facility reliability roadmap that guarantees maximum uptime and adheres to the highest safety and regulatory benchmarks.

  • Synthesize technical expertise with Maintenance and Production departments to integrate reliability-centered design into all new equipment installations and system upgrades.

  • Engineer strategic initiatives aimed at systemic failure elimination across production lines, utility infrastructures, and automated control systems.

  • Orchestrate the deployment of sophisticated maintenance protocols, including high-value preventive routines and cutting-edge predictive/non-destructive testing technologies.

  • Analyze recurring mechanical or electrical bottlenecks to engineer permanent technical solutions that bolster throughput and product quality while reducing operational overhead.

  • Champion the technical growth of the on-site maintenance crew by designing and delivering advanced training modules to elevate internal troubleshooting capabilities.

  • Drive rapid-response technical support during critical equipment outages, partnering with field teams to restore peak performance efficiently.


What You Bring

  • Technical Foundation: A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Electrical, or Industrial Engineering.

  • Industry Expertise: 2–5 years of dedicated experience in Reliability Engineering or as a Reliability Specialist within a high-volume manufacturing environment.

  • Leadership Background: Prior experience in a maintenance leadership or supervisory capacity is highly coveted.

  • Problem-Solving Prowess: A demonstrated ability to dissect complex engineering hurdles and implement sustainable, data-driven improvements.

  • Tactical Execution: A hands-on professional who thrives in the field, collaborating directly with technicians and operators to solve real-world machinery issues.

  • Domain Knowledge: Familiarity with the unique demands of polymer additives or plastics compounding is an asset.

  • Communication Skills: Exceptional ability to articulate technical strategies to diverse stakeholders through clear reporting and persuasive presentations.
